Absolutely she has changed in width from behind. Anyone who knows can tell when foal is sideways turning itself around to foaling position. She is def. ready . Her bags are filled to the line. Nips ready to pop. Don't always point outward. Depends on mare. Sometimes point out but not all the time that I've seen in mares.The baby def is in position. Her hips are sunken in and softened makin way for foal to pass. She'll have foal w/ in 1-2 after waxing usually. Just my guess. A safe and healthy. Keep us posted!!
